Career path

Career Role (Trade Sanctions Monitoring) Description
Compliance Analyst (Trade Sanctions) Investigate transactions, screen clients, and ensure adherence to international trade sanctions regulations. High demand due to increasing global scrutiny.
Financial Crime Investigator (Sanctions Specialist) Identify and investigate suspicious financial activity related to sanctions violations. Requires strong analytical and investigative skills.
Trade Compliance Manager (Sanctions Focus) Develop and implement robust trade compliance programs, including sanctions screening and due diligence procedures. A senior role with significant responsibility.
Sanctions Screening Specialist Utilize sanctions screening software and databases to identify potential sanctions breaches. Key role in preventing non-compliance.
Regulatory Reporting Officer (Sanctions) Prepare and submit regulatory reports related to sanctions compliance. Ensures accurate and timely reporting to authorities.
